"The UnCREATIVE Writing"

"The UnCREATIVE Writing" refers to a form of writing that relies heavily on copying, imitating, or recycling existing ideas and styles without adding original thought or innovation. It often involves repetitive, predictable language, lacking imagination or fresh perspectives. This approach can produce work that feels uninspired or derivative, reducing the impact and authenticity of the message. Essentially, it highlights a mode of writing that prioritizes surface-level reproduction over creative expression, emphasizing the importance of originality and critical thinking in meaningful communication.
